World’s Highest Bridge in China Cuts Travel Time Dramatically

The world’s highest bridge, located in China, has made headlines for its remarkable engineering and the transformative impact it has on travel times. Standing at an impressive height, this architectural marvel not only showcases human ingenuity but also significantly enhances connectivity in the region. The bridge, which spans a deep valley, dramatically reduces travel time, cutting it down from an hour to just one minute. This incredible reduction in journey time is a game-changer for commuters and travelers alike, allowing for swift and efficient transit across challenging terrains that would have otherwise taken much longer to navigate.

Constructed to connect two vital areas, this bridge serves as a vital link for local residents, businesses, and tourists. Before its completion, the lengthy detour required for crossing the valley posed challenges for those traveling between the two regions.
